Transaction 50f7d36f16b152739f405128c0754c71c7c325fe60fb1dc157088a3e476986e3
1 Input
1 Output
-
50f7d36f16b152739f405128c0754c71c7c325fe60fb1dc157088a3e476986e3:0
- value
- 261514506
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58f170ebcd399a68e65184302c9a984d33c3eabf OP_EQUALVERIFY OP_CHECKSIG
- address
- 197HhW9y7H83TDYm9dUGx9b4MsBp86QhJT